Pacote Linux LPI

CARGA HORÁRIA: 144 horas
112 horas presencial + 32 horas de exercícios com máquina virtual.
APRESENTAÇÃO
Este curso abrange a instalação e a configuração do sistema operacional Linux, linha de comandos do Linux, comandos básicos e avançados, como instalar pacotes inserir espaço (programas no Linux), boas práticas como administração de contas de usuários e gerenciamento de cotas.
Configuração dos servidores como servidor web, servidor DNS, servidores de arquivo SAMBA (PDC), entre outros, muito comum sob o sistema operacional Linux, de modo que você seja capaz de administrar os servidores executando e implantando aplicações. Os participantes irão aprender os princípios básicos de redes baseadas em TCP/IP, configuração de Linux para trabalhar com redes TCP/IP e configuração de rede básica de serviços como SSH e servidor de DNS.
Principais Tópicos Abordados
● Instalação do Linux Debian;
● Configuração do Linux em Modo texto e Gráfico;
● Comandos básicos e avançados;
● Personalização da área de trabalho;
● Otimização do sistema conforme as necessidades do usuário;
● Gerenciamento de serviços;
● Automatização de tarefas;
● Gerenciamento de contas de usuários;
● Criação de Scripts;
● Instalação e Configuração dos seguintes servidores:
● Servidor de Web - LAMP (Linux , Apache, MYSQL e PHP) para hospedagem de websites;
● Servidor FTP – para armazenamento de arquivos;
● Servidor de e-mail – PostFix , Webmail;
● Servidor SAMBA – para redes mistas (Windows x Linux);
● Servidor PROXY/SQUID – gerenciamento e cache de acesso à internet;
● Servidor Firewall – Segurança na rede contra invasões;
PÚBLICO ALVO
Este curso é designado para técnicos de suporte, administradores de sistemas, usuários que desejam aprender sobre o mundo do software livre, administradores de redes e servidores, que têm necessidade de instalar e administrar conexões de rede com outras redes, inclusive da Internet e das redes locais como redes mistas Microsoft (Samba). Os participantes irão aprender a trabalhar em Linux para configurar redes TCP/IP, configuração básica de redes e serviços como SSH, servidor de DNS e muito mais.
VANTAGENS E PONTOS FORTES DO CURSO
• O curso é totalmente prático e presencial, com acompanhamento dos instrutores, reforçado pelo ambiente de ensino à distância (e-learning-moodle) para realização de exercícios de fixação dos conteúdos ministrados. • Também é disponibilizada uma máquina virtual com Linux para cada aluno durante o treinamento via internet para prática de comandos e configuração do sistema. configuração do sistema. • Treinamento atualizado com as melhores práticas do mercado de Software Livre.
PRÉ-REQUISITOS
Conhecimento básico em informática.
EMENTA
Módulo I
Distribuição Utilizada: Linux Debian
Unidade I – Introdução
Apresentação Filosofia do Software Livre Projeto GNU
GNU/Linux
Kernel Distribuições Principais componentes do Linux
Conceitos básicos
Unidade II – Primeiros Passos
Entrando no sistema
Utilizando um interpretador de comandos
Ambiente gráfico
Uso da documentação do Linux
Saindo do sistema
Unidade III – Linha de Comando
Uso do GNU/Linux através da linha de comando
Conceitos básicos do SHELL
Ajuste do ambiente de usuários e as variáveis de sistema
Comandos essenciais de um Sistema Linux
Redirecionamento da entrada e saída padrão
Uso de curingas
Expressões regulares
Filtros e processadores de texto
Uso de editores de texto (vi)
Unidade IV – Estrutura de Diretórios e Sistema de Arquivos
Estrutura do sistema de arquivos
Diretórios do sistema
Comandos de manipulação e gerenciamento de arquivos
Navegando no sistema de arquivos
Localizando arquivos
Criando e alterando Hardlinks e Softlinks
Unidade V – Permissões de arquivos
Gerenciando permissões de arquivos
Controle de acesso aos arquivos
Gerenciando donos de arquivos e permissões de grupos
Unidade VI - Gerenciamento de processos
Criando, monitorando e matando processos
Trabalhando com Jobs
Modificando as prioridades de execução dos processos
Unidade VII - Gerenciamento de Pacotes
Usando DPKG – Debian Package Manager
Usando APT
Compilando e instalando programas a partir do código fonte
Gerenciamento de bibliotecas compartilhadas
Unidade VIII - Instalação do GNU/Linux
Modos de instalação
Instalação do sistema GNU/Linux (Debian)
Unidade IX – Processo de Inicialização
O processo de BOOT
Gerenciadores de inicialização
Níveis de execução
Entendendo o sistema de gerenciamento de serviços
Unidade X – Recursos Avançados do Shell
Otimização e uso das variáveis de ambiente Shell Bash
Uso de Shell scripting
Unidade XI - Automação de Tarefas
Automatização de tarefas administrativas
Agendamento de tarefas
Unidade XII - Gerenciamento de Contas de Usuários
Criando, modificando e removendo contas de usuários
Criando, modificando e removendo grupos de usuários
Gerenciando o uso de senhas e níveis de segurança
Unidade XIII – Kernel
Gerenciando módulos do kernel
Instalando um novo kernel
Construindo, compilando e instalando um Kernel otimizado
Unidade XIV – Controle de Dispositivos e Gerência do Sistema de Arquivos
Dispositivos de armazenamento
Criando e mantendo sistemas de arquivos
Gerenciando a integridade e a montagem dos sistemas de arquivos
Unidade XV – Sistema de Impressão
Administrando filas de impressão
Sistema de impressão CUPS
Comandos de impressão
Arquivos de configuração do sistema de impressão
Instalando e configurando impressoras locais e remotas
Unidade X – Sistema X-Window
Instalando e configurando o sistema Xorg
Trabalhando com gerenciadores de gráficos de login
Trabalhando com gerenciadores de janelas
Módulo II
Unidade I - Conceitos de TCP/IP
Ambiente de rede
Tecnologias
Protocolos
Fundamentos do TCP/IP
Unidade II – Ferramentas de Rede
Arquivos de configuração da rede
Configurando o ambiente de rede
Resolvendo problemas
Configurando e gerenciando o INET.D e XINET.D
Unidade III – Acesso Remoto
Serviço VNC
Serviço XDMCP
OpenSSH
Unidade IV - Serviços de Rede
DHCP (Dynamic Host Configuration Protocol)
DNS (Domain Name System)
NFS (Network File System)
SAMBA (Servidor de Arquivos)
FTP (File Transfer Protocol)
Conceitos básicos sobre:
Correio eletrônico (Sendmail, Postfix, Imap e pop3)
Servidor Web (Apache)
Unidade V - Segurança
Segurança da informação
Procedimentos de Segurança
Firewalling, NAT, iptables Proxy/cache (Squid)
INSTRUTOR
Certificado LPIC-1, palestrante em diversos eventos, participante em projetos de expansão do software livre.
|